A 25-year-old man crashed his car into a parked vehicle, causing it to roll onto the roof early Monday morning, Denver police said.

Darian Windom was cited with careless driving, driving under restraint and driving without insurance, said Doug Schepman, a Denver police spokesman.

The crash happened at about 6:12 a.m. on Kalamath Street near 12th Avenue.

Windom allegedly told a Denver police officer: “I know I should not be driving and was going next week to fix my license.”

Windom was not injured in the crash.
